Les Cours Mont-Royal stands as one of Montréal’s most iconic lifestyle office destinations, blending historic prestige with modern workplace design. Once the largest hotel in the British Empire, 1555 Peel Street has been reimagined as a landmark mixed-use complex in the heart of downtown.
With 100,000 square feet of office space available, the building offers flexible leasing options ranging from adaptable layouts from boutique offices of 700 square feet to full floors of 20,000 square feet, including furnished plug-and-play suites. Tenants enjoy unmatched amenities such as a four-season rooftop pool with panoramic city views, a private health club and fitness center with squash courts and steam rooms, an expansive rooftop terrace, a state-of-the-art conference center, a modern tenant lounge and common areas, on-site parking, and direct access to Peel Metro Station.
